BonV Aero, an innovative deep-tech startup launched a new range of modular drone pods that will enhance logistics in some of India’s most challenging and hard-to-reach regions. These versatile pods are being designed to support essential sectors like healthcare, defence, emergency relief, and environmental protection, where conventional delivery methods often fail to meet demands.

“Our systems are built to address practical needs,” said Satyabrata Satapathy, Co-founder and CEO of BonV Aero. “We aim to deliver reliable solutions to regions where traditional logistics simply can’t keep up.”

The company’s drone pods are being designed for a range of applications—from cold-chain logistics for medical supplies to safe transportation of sensitive equipment, food, and other essential goods. In pilot tests in Uttarakhand, BonV Aero has shown that drone delivery can reduce vaccine delivery times from nearly five hours by road to under an hour, providing a faster, more reliable alternative.

The pods are also being configured for use in high-risk and remote areas, including military zones and regions impacted by natural disasters. Their quick deployment capabilities ensure that critical supplies reach their destination faster, without the constraints of road access or difficult terrain.

In response to the rise in environmental challenges, such as forest fires and extreme weather, BonV Aero’s drone systems will be capable of quick action. The pods will support aerial fire suppression and real-time monitoring, with modular capabilities that allow for precise payload delivery, even in areas where landing isn’t an option. Additionally, tethered pods will provide continuous surveillance or communication for extended periods, enhancing operational capacity.
